Good news for fans of prolific voice actor Fairouz Ai. The actor, maybe best known for her role as Jolyne Cujoh in J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ure (and her love of said franchise) announced back in January that she would be taking a break from work after being diagnosed with post-traumatic stress disorder.
Now Fairouz has announced via X that she will be returning to work. She also announced that she has switched talent agencies from Raccoon Dog to Mausu Promotion.
In a message to her fans, Fairouz wrote in part: “Your presence has been a great encouragement to me, as you have not rushed or pestered me about my return, but have simply waited for me kindly and sent me many heartfelt letters.”
Other Fairouz credits include Kikoru Shinomiya in Kaiju No. 8, Nao Umiyama in 365 Days to the Wedding; Gremory in Akuma-kun; Belle Lablac in Bye Bye, Earth; Power in Chainsaw Man; Delta in The Eminence in Shadow; Raelza in Handyman Saitō in Another World; Hibiki Sakura in How Heavy Are the Dumbbells You Lift?; Sumire in In the Heart of Kunoichi Tsubaki; Masked Wonder in Magical Girl Raising Project Restart; Rinia Dedorudia in Mushoku Tensei: Jobless Reincarnation; Marguerite in My Daughter Left the Nest and Returned an S-Rank Adventurer; Alisa in Pokémon Concierge; Slime in Ragna Crimson; Gawain in The Seven Deadly Sins: Four Knights of the Apocalypse; and Nelia Cunningham in The Vexations of a Shut-In Vampire Princess, among many others.
